ffgg

Matlab画三维指向性图(不懂,但是能画)

链接: 参考链接
在这里插入图片描述

l = 3;
m = 0;
t = 0 : pi / 100 : 2 * pi;
le = legendre(l, cos(t));
R = le(m + 1, :) .^ 2;

p = (0 : 50)' / 25 * pi;
x = ones(size(p)) * (R .* cos(t));
y = R .* sin(t);
z = cos(p) * y;
y = sin(p) * y;
h = polar(t, R);
surface(x, y, z)
h.LineWidth = 4;

作者:曲伽西
链接:https://www.zhihu.com/question/275373736/answer/379802647
来源:知乎
著作权归作者所有。商业转载请联系作者获得授权,非商业转载请注明出处。

p不用改,t和R都是行向量就行

posted on 2023-07-05 22:11  壹肆叁贰海里  阅读(1)  评论(0编辑  收藏  举报  来源

导航